Description

No beginners


Ascent: The hike starts from the train station "Ehrwald Zugspitzbahn". You have to follow the trail "801" which goes to Wiener-Neustädter-Hütte. After crossing the ski slope, the terrain becomes steep an it goes through gravel. You have to very careful in this section as there are very small stones often on the track. After approximately two hours of hiking, you will reach the a point where the path from Eibsee converges. The views of Eibsee are breathtaking here. After this the trail becomes very narrow and often secured with the rope. A helmet is highly recommended in this part. Soon you will arrive at the hut Wiener-Neustädter-Hütte.

From the hut, you need 15 min to the via ferrata entry point. The via ferrata is grade A/B, and a helmet is mandatory for it. After 2-3 hours in the via ferrata, you will arrive at the summit. 

Descent: We take the cable car down. 

  • carry cash (cable car ticket is 32€)
Good to know
  1. Hiking shoes and via ferrata set
  2. Hiking poles (not mandatory, but it always better to have them).
  3. Enough water for the whole day.
  4. Snacks and or food.
  5. Proper clothes for hiking (it could be windy at the peak) 
  6. A good mood
